  67. mr. orange 7 years ago

    Not really something I like tonight. NAC to win both halves is an option, but it is the first home game with their new manager.

    Dutch Eredivisie:

    Groningen v Vitesse (Saturday)

    Both are attacking sides who are 5th and 6th on the list of most shots per game. Groningen leads the list of most shots conceded per game, so I think there is a big chance we see goals in this game. Groningen always have a goal or two in them and they are at home. Vitesse only failed to score in 2 games all season, away at Ajax and at home to PSV. They only kept 3 clean sheets this season, all against bottom half teams. BTTS is backable @ 1.72, but I will take the odds available for an extra goal.

    Over 2.5 match goals @ 1.91 with 888 / unibet

    Excelsior v Go Ahead Eagles (Sunday)

    A relegation battle in Rotterdam on Sunday. Excelsior can score goals, but can’t defend. They scored 2 and 3 goals against teams like Heracles, Groningen, AZ, Sparta and NEC, but only had 1 clean sheet all season. I can see Eagles conceding 2 or 3. Go Ahead have to start winning games and have nothing to lose. I think we will see an open game which should produce some goals.

    Over 2.5 match goals @ 1.91 with 888 / unibet

  139. Jordan 7 years ago

    Write up for the Baggies punts that I posted earlier today.

    As I mentioned I had them tabbed up on the browser for a day or too and today their goals started to shorten after a small drift yesterday. While form over the last five doesn’t set these two far apart, home vs away over the same period sets a different tone. Sunderland are hurting badly in the injury department and have a few names at the AFCON cup, with David Moyes likely having to play the same XI that lost 3-1 to Stoke last time out, with a few changes made to their FA Cup exit at Turf Moor midweek with Defoe and O’Shea rested despite having to bring on their top scorer for the last 25 minutes to attempt their failed comeback. Now they are out of the FA Cup their next target is survival, which for me is unlike. Only four points on their travels this season, conceding in every game and 2+ in their last four on the road (3+ against Burnley and Swansea). They do well to gain a point here against a Baggies side who have 17 of their 29 points at home this season, winning four of their last five at home with their only loss against an ‘in-form’ Manchester United. In all four of those wins they’ve scored 3+, which to me spells bad news for the Mackems who played midweek.

    In my opinion, Matt Phillips has been one of the most underrated players this season. Tony Pulis got a bargain for £6.5 million last summer, and he’s easily eclipsed that sum with 4 goals and 8 assists with plenty of games left to add. West Brom don’t have a player who scores week in/out, but Phillips plays a key part in their attack has scored twice in his last four outings (one FA Cup tie).

    The reverse tie in Sunderland ended 1-1, but West Brom peppered the home goal all afternoon with 17 attempts to Sunderland’s 7, so I’d expect the same type of game, but this time a couple of goals for the Baggies, hopefully one for the Scot too.

    Sunderland have lost 6 of their last 7 at the Hawthorns, conceding 2+ in five. They may score, but I don’t expect them to outscore West Brom.

    Saturday – Premier League – 3:00PM

    West Brom Over 1.5 Team Goals @ 17/20 @ Bet Victor – 4 points (Best now @ 5/6 @ Various)

    Matt Phillips (West Brom) Anytime @ 10/3 @ Marathon Bet – 1 point
